基于Visual C++2010与windows7 SDK开发传感器应用(触觉传感器,温度传感器等等)

本文介绍了Windows 7操作系统对传感器设备的内置支持,包括设备驱动程序接口、传感器API和定位API。Windows提供标准方法与传感器设备交互,传感器API包括ISensorManager、ISensor和ISensorDataReport接口。定位API允许开发者简单地获取地理位置数据,同时考虑用户隐私。控制面板允许用户管理传感器的启用和隐私设置。
摘要由CSDN通过智能技术生成

 

 

Windows 7操作系统提供了对传感器设备的内置支持。这包括对位置传感器的支持,如GPS设备。作为这种支持的一部分,Windows传感器和位置平台提供了一种设备制造的标准方法,以使软件开发商和客户能够正确感知传感器设备。同时,该平台为开发人员提供一个标准化的API和设备驱动程序接口(DDI)与传感器和传感器的数据协同工作。

传感器用于获取多种配置,从这个角度来看,几乎所有的东西,只要能提供有关的物理现象的数据都可以被称为一个传感器。虽然我们通常把硬件设备才认为是传感器。逻辑式传感器也可以通过在提供软件或固件传感器的功能,提供仿真的信息。此外,单一的硬件设备可以包含多个传感器。

Windows平台中,传感器和地点组织成类。而代表传感器设备的两大类是传感器和类型。例如,在视频游戏控制器,检测的位置和球员的手部动作(也许是视频保龄球游戏),传感器将被归类为导向传感器,但它的类型为三维加速度计。在代码,Windows是通过使用全局唯一标识符(GUID)来识别不同的传感器,其中有许多预定义的类别和类型。当它需要新的类别和类型,设备制造商可以通过确定和发布新的GUID

定位设备组成一个特别有趣的类别。现在,大多数人都对全球定位系统(GPS)熟悉。在Windows中,全球定位系统传感器作为位置类别的一部分,位置类还包括其他的传感器类型。这些传感器有些是基于软件的,例如IP解析器,提供以位置信息为基础的互联网地址,移动电话塔triangulator,决定在附近的塔,或者一个Wi - Fi提供的网络位置读取位置信息的定位无线网络连接的枢纽。

Windows传感器和定位平台由以下开发者和用户组成部分:

  • 直通内线使Windows以提供一个传感器设备的标准方法连接到电脑,并提供数据,其他子系统。
  • Windows API提供了传感器的方法,属性设置和活动
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

尹成

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值